| 1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859 |
- -- 2023-04-03
- alter table meeting add `BeginAt` datetime DEFAULT NULL COMMENT '预约开始时段' after Scale;
- alter table meeting add `EndAt` datetime DEFAULT NULL COMMENT '预约结束时段' after BeginAt;
- CREATE TABLE `announcement` (
- `Title` varchar(32)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'标题',
- `Content` text CO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'内容',
- `Sender` varchar(32)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'发送者',
- `SenderId` int(11) DEFAULT NULL COMMENT '发送者ID',
- `Status` int(11) DEFAULT NULL COMMENT '状态',
- `DeptId` int(11) NOT NULL COMMENT '部门Id',
- `DeptName` varchar(255) NOT NULL COMMENT '部门名称',
- `PublishTime` datetime DEFAULT NULL COMMENT '发布时间',
- `Id` int(11) NOT NULL AUTO_INCREMENT COMMENT '主键ID',
- `CreatedBy` varchar(32)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'创建人',
- `CreatedAt` datetime NOT NULL COMMENT '创建时间',
- `UpdatedBy` varchar(32)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'更新人',
- `UpdatedAt` datetime NOT NULL COMMENT '更新时间',
- `DeletedAt` datetime DEFAULT NULL COMMENT '删除时间',
- `CreatedById` int(11) NOT NULL COMMENT '创建人ID',
- `UpdatedById` int(11) NOT NULL COMMENT '更新人ID',
- `ReceiverDevice` text CO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'接收设备的终端编码',
- `Link` text CO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'链接',
- `IsTop` tinyint(1) DEFAULT NULL COMMENT '是否置顶',
- PRIMARY KEY (`Id`) USING BTREE
- )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ci ROW_FORMAT = DYNAMIC COMMENT = '公告';
- CREATE TABLE `announcement_file` (
- `Id` int(11) NOT NULL AUTO_INCREMENT COMMENT '主键ID',
- `MessageId` int(11) DEFAULT NULL COMMENT '消息id',
- `FileName` varchar(128)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'资料名称',
- `FileUrl` varchar(128)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'资料url',
- `FileId` varchar(50)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'文件服务ID',
- `FileSize` varchar(25)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'大小',
- `FileExtend` varchar(25)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'扩展名',
- `CreatedBy` varchar(32)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'创建人',
- `CreatedAt` datetime DEFAULT NULL COMMENT '创建时间',
- `UpdatedBy` varchar(32) COLLATE utf8mb4_unicode_ci DEFAULT NULL COMMENT '更新人',
- `UpdatedAt` datetime DEFAULT NULL COMMENT '更新时间',
- `DeletedAt` datetime DEFAULT NULL COMMENT '删除时间',
- KEY (`MessageId`),
- PRIMARY KEY (`Id`) USING BTREE
- )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ci ROW_FORMAT = DYNAMIC COMMENT = '公告附件信息表';
- CREATE TABLE `announcement_read_record` (
- `Id` int(11) NOT NULL AUTO_INCREMENT COMMENT '主键ID',
- `MessageId` int(11) DEFAULT NULL COMMENT '消息id',
- `UserId` int(11) DEFAULT NULL COMMENT '消息id',
- `CreatedBy` varchar(32)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'创建人',
- `CreatedAt` datetime NOT NULL COMMENT '创建时间',
- `UpdatedBy` varchar(32)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'更新人',
- `UpdatedAt` datetime NOT NULL COMMENT '更新时间',
- `DeletedAt` datetime DEFAULT NULL COMMENT '删除时间',
- `CreatedById` int(11) NOT NULL COMMENT '创建人ID',
- `UpdatedById` int(11) NOT NULL COMMENT '更新人ID',
- KEY (`MessageId`),
- KEY (`UserId`),
- PRIMARY KEY (`Id`) USING BTREE
- )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ci ROW_FORMAT = DYNAMIC COMMENT = '公告已读记录';
|